How to Design a Sportsbook

A sportsbook is a gambling establishment that accepts bets on various sporting events. They make money by setting odds for each bet that will guarantee a profit over the long term. In the United States, the only fully legal sportsbooks are in Nevada, although a recent Supreme Court decision has made it possible for these to operate in other states as well. If you’re interested in starting a sportsbook, there are several things you need to consider before making the final decision.

The first step is to determine what kind of user base you want to target. This will help you choose the best development technology and comply with any legal regulations that apply to your jurisdiction. If you’re not familiar with these laws, it’s a good idea to consult with a legal expert.

When it comes to designing a sportsbook, you need to be sure that your users will be able to sign up without any problems. This means that the registration and verification process must be easy and fast. Users should also be able to attach documents without any hassle, and these should be stored with the utmost security.

Another thing to keep in mind when building a sportsbook is that you need to offer a wide range of betting options. If you only have a few leagues to choose from, your users will be turned off by the lack of choice. You should also include a rewards system in your product to give your users an incentive to continue using it.

Lastly, you need to be sure that your sportsbook has the right technical capabilities. You will need to have a high-speed server and a reliable network in order to be able to support the massive amounts of data that sportsbooks generate. You’ll also need to have a strong team of developers and technical support personnel who can handle any issues that may arise.

In addition to the above considerations, you should also do a bit of research on your competition. Look at their websites and find out what features they offer. Then, try to figure out how your sportsbook can compete with them. For example, you might want to consider offering a live chat feature that will allow customers to communicate with a representative of the sportsbook.

Lastly, be sure that your sportsbook offers a variety of payment methods. Some sportsbooks have flat-fee subscription services, while others charge per head. The latter option can be expensive for a small business, as it will cost you the same amount of money whether you’re winning or losing. However, a pay-per-head sportsbook will allow you to save money during slow months and keep more cash in your bankroll during busy times. This is a great way to grow your business and ensure its longevity.